Today's Solved Paper(Subject wise )

*Geography and History*


1. Pakistan is the world's fifth most populous
country.
2. East Pakistan separated in 1971.
3. Thal Canal originates from the Jhelum
River in Punjab.
4. Indus River is the "Mother of Rivers".
5. Lloyd Barrage honors George Lloyd and
is now known as Sukkur Barrage.
6. Bosnia and Herzegovina gained
independence in 1992.
7. ADB HQ is in Manila, Philippines.
8. Arab League HQ is in Cairo, Egypt.
*Politics and Government*
1. Malik Ishaq led Lashkar-e-Jhangvi.
2. Hosni Mubarak was removed in 2011 after
30 years in power.
3. Pervez Musharraf wrote "In the Line of
Fire".
4. Pervez Musharraf took oath in 2001 before
the 2002 general elections.
5. Iskander Mirza was Pakistan's first
president.
6. Sergey Lavrov is Russia's Foreign
Minister.
7. Kamala Harris is the USA's Vice President.
8. Benazir Bhutto was assassinated on
December 27, 2007.

*Science and Technology*


1. Federico Faggin is the microprocessor's
father.
2. Grace Hopper conceived the compiler idea.
3. Ray Tomlinson sent the first email.
4. Ctrl+S saves PowerPoint presentations.
5. Ctrl+E centers alignment.
6. Ctrl+H replaces and finds.
7. MATCH function returns relative
positions in Excel.
8. Page Layout changes portrait to landscape.
9. Justify alignment is used for left and right
alignment.
10. Heat unit is BTU.
11. NaCl is an electrolyte.
12. Catalysts increase chemical reaction rates.
13. Amplifiers are semiconductor devices.
14. LSI stands for Large-Scale Integration.
